Shared mutable state is the root of all evil(共享的可变状态是万恶之源) -- Pete Hunt 有人说 Immutable 可以给 React 应用带来数十倍的提升,也有人说 Immutable 的引入是近期 JavaScript 中伟大的发明,因为同 ...
分类:
其他 时间:
2016-12-26 23:50:54
收藏:
0 评论:
0 赞:
0 阅读:
393
.Net开源微型ORM框架测评 什么是ORM? 对象关系映射(英语:Object Relation Mapping,简称ORM,或O/RM,或O/R mapping),是一种程序技术,用于实现面向对象编程语言里不同类型系统的数据之间的转换。从效果上说,它其实是创建了一个可在编程语言里使用的“虚拟对象 ...
分类:
其他 时间:
2016-12-26 23:50:40
收藏:
0 评论:
0 赞:
0 阅读:
315
一:递归的概念 在一个函数中再次调用该函数自身的行为叫做递归,这样的函数被称作递归函数。需要注意的是,递归函数中的参数或者函数中的某一变量的值肯定会改变,若不改变,则函数在自己调用自己的过程中,没有标志函数停止的标志,函数会陷入死循环。 如:void digui1(){ printf("a\n"); ...
分类:
编程语言 时间:
2016-12-26 23:50:21
收藏:
0 评论:
0 赞:
0 阅读:
312
当你使用larvel创建一个相对比较复杂的web网站时,往往你的routes文件就会变得很庞大。一般来说在开始网站编码之前,最好做一个整体规划,把这些route逻辑上划分为不同的group,每一个group来定一个对应的middleware来控制这些route的访问。比如admin,auth,pub ...
分类:
其他 时间:
2016-12-26 23:50:03
收藏:
0 评论:
0 赞:
0 阅读:
269
模型浏览器: 在之前的章节中,我们创建了第一个关于学校的实体数据模型。但是EDM设计器并没有将他所创建的所有对象完全显示出来。它只将数据库中的被选择的表与视图显示出来了。 模型浏览器可以将EDM所创建的所有对象和函数的信息都显示出来。右键EDM设计器并在菜单中选择模型浏览器即可打开。 模型浏览器包含 ...
分类:
其他 时间:
2016-12-26 23:49:31
收藏:
0 评论:
0 赞:
0 阅读:
278
<script type="text/javascript" charset="utf-8" src="{$Think.config.PLUGIN_URL}ueditor/ueditor.config.js"></script><script type="text/javascript" chars ...
分类:
其他 时间:
2016-12-26 23:49:06
收藏:
0 评论:
0 赞:
0 阅读:
353
结构目录如下: 其中: dao层和entity层都属于hibernate的的管辖。entity层里面装的是每张表对应的持久化类。dao层里面装的是“底层操作数据库的行为”,仅仅只是单纯的增删查改等。(创建步骤是:先定义dao接口,再定义该dao接口各个impl实现类)。 service层属于spri ...
分类:
编程语言 时间:
2016-12-26 23:48:49
收藏:
0 评论:
0 赞:
0 阅读:
293
最近做了一个移动项目,是有服务器和客户端类型的项目,客户端是要登录才行的,服务器也会返回数据,服务器是用Java开发的,客户端要同时支持多平台(Android、iOS),在处理iOS的数据加密的时候遇到了一些问题。起初采取的方案是DES加密,老大说DES加密是对称的,网络抓包加上反编译可能会被破解, ...
分类:
移动平台 时间:
2016-12-26 23:47:31
收藏:
0 评论:
0 赞:
0 阅读:
239
(1)、编写配置文件 Hibernate通过读写默认的XML配置文件hibernate.cfg.xml加载数据库配置信息、代码如下: (2)、编写持久化类 持久化类是Hibernate操作的对象、它与数据库中的数据表相对应 (3)、编写映射文件 (4)、编写Hibernate的工具类 ...
分类:
Web开发 时间:
2016-12-26 23:47:11
收藏:
0 评论:
0 赞:
0 阅读:
303
Python之路【第三篇】:Python基础(二) 内置函数 一 详细见python文档,猛击这里 文件操作 操作文件时,一般需要经历如下步骤: 打开文件 操作文件 一、打开文件 1 文件句柄 = file('文件路径', '模式') 1 文件句柄 = file('文件路径', '模式') 1 文件 ...
分类:
编程语言 时间:
2016-12-26 23:46:32
收藏:
0 评论:
0 赞:
0 阅读:
354
【状态模式 例子】 【运行结果】 【 策略模式 与 状态模式 区别!!】 * 封装的不同 [ 策略模式 ]封装的是不同的算法,算法之间没有交互,以达到算法可以自由切换的目的。 [ 状态模式 ]封装的是不同的状态,以达到状态岁切换行为随之发生改变的目的。 两者都有变换的行为,但是两者的目标是不同的。 ...
分类:
其他 时间:
2016-12-26 23:46:12
收藏:
0 评论:
0 赞:
0 阅读:
304
Python之路【第二篇】:Python基础(一) 入门知识拾遗 一、作用域 对于变量的作用域,执行声明并在内存中存在,该变量就可以在下面的代码中使用。 1 2 3 if 1==1: name = 'wupeiqi' print name 下面的结论对吗? 外层变量,可以被内层变量使用 内层变量,无 ...
分类:
编程语言 时间:
2016-12-26 23:45:36
收藏:
0 评论:
0 赞:
0 阅读:
326
Spring Boot 提供了一种方式 --类型安全的bean,能够根据类型校验和管理application中的bean.继续使用author做例子。配置放在author.properties文件中。属性必须命名规范才能绑定成功。 上例中我们用@ConfigurationProperties注解就可 ...
分类:
编程语言 时间:
2016-12-26 23:45:21
收藏:
0 评论:
0 赞:
0 阅读:
303
1>C:\Program Files (x86)\MSBuild\Microsoft.Cpp\v4.0\V120\Microsoft.CppBuild.targets(369,5): error MSB8031: Building an MFC project for a non-Unicode c ...
分类:
其他 时间:
2016-12-26 23:45:04
收藏:
0 评论:
0 赞:
0 阅读:
227
转载http://blog.csdn.net/Shayabean_/article/details/44885917博客 先说说基数排序的思想: 基数排序是非比较型的排序算法,其原理是将整数按位数切割成不同的数字,然后按每个位数分别比较。 将所有待比较数值(正整数)统一为同样的数位长度,数位较短的数 ...
分类:
编程语言 时间:
2016-12-26 22:04:53
收藏:
0 评论:
0 赞:
0 阅读:
413
参数data数据格式data = [{'aa':123,'bb':456,'cc':789},{'aa':321,'bb':444,'cc':555},{'aa':888,'bb':259,'cc':1000}] key为要排序的键 def bubble_sort(data,key): length ...
分类:
编程语言 时间:
2016-12-26 22:04:29
收藏:
0 评论:
0 赞:
0 阅读:
436
介绍:Free Video Compressor 是一个免费视频压缩软件,可以帮您有效的压缩视频、电影文件的体积大小,减小占用的磁盘空间,使之更容易放到手机中保存播放Free Video Compressor软件特色:1.First of all, the most important option ...
分类:
其他 时间:
2016-12-26 22:03:51
收藏:
0 评论:
0 赞:
0 阅读:
334
本文转载自: https://www.insp.top/article/composer-mirror-image 常见的: 其中 url 可替换为以下地址: http://composer-proxy.jp/proxy/packagist http://comproxy.cn/repo/packa ...
分类:
其他 时间:
2016-12-26 22:02:53
收藏:
0 评论:
0 赞:
0 阅读:
303
系统环境:centOS5版本和centOS6版本 客户端的版本:nfs-utils-1.2.3 挂载使用的是默认的参数。 异常现象: 当nfs服务端出现异常时,客户端挂载会不断的去尝试连接nfs服务端,导致客户端使用df命令显示挂载的文件系统时出现卡死,有时候使用Ctrl+C可以解决,可能是由于该挂 ...
分类:
其他 时间:
2016-12-26 22:02:16
收藏:
0 评论:
0 赞:
0 阅读:
568
转自:http://blog.csdn.net/cailiwei712/article/details/7998525 在查看内核驱动代码的时候会经常看到在一些函数后面总会跟EXPORT_SYMBOL()这样的宏定义,通过网上查阅,它的作用大致总结如下: 1、定义说明 把内核函数的符号导出,也可以理 ...
分类:
其他 时间:
2016-12-26 22:01:45
收藏:
0 评论:
0 赞:
0 阅读:
288